Students of the Broadway School - 1914
Fait partie de Hopkins, Charles Hillary fonds
Students of the Broadway School on its front steps 1914. Back Row: L to R: Reg Lancaster, Mac Irvine, Verne Leake, Beverly Leake, Katie Sparrow (now Mrs. Elmo Price), Allardyce Code, Kathleen Slinn, Ruth Code, Alice Clift (Mrs. J. Hopkins), Helen Johnson, Kathleen Clift (Mrs. Sam Smith), Mable Lovell; Centre Row: Clifford Whitmore, Rollo Bedham, Levita McNaughton, Ruby Severson, Myrtle Hodgenson, Laura Roberts, Lizzie Leathem, Ruth Elliott, Nellie Slinn, Hazel Rusk, Lily smith, Laura Lovell, Mattie Simpson. Bottom Row: Arthur Lindsay, Harold Long, Stacey Foster, Elmo Price, Henry Clark, Charles Davidson, Emerson Wittig, Hans Nelson, Axel Monsees, Arthur Foster, Dick Dawson.
Y.M.C.C. Carnival in Melfort, Sask.
Fait partie de James Chatterton Clark Collection
Twenty-three people at the Y.M.C.C. Carnival in Melfort, Saskatchewan. They are all wearing costumes and ice skates and holding hockey sticks, but for the man kneeling in front as he holds a fire axe. Another is hidden in the back and waves his hand. L to R Alex McKay, ?, Max Nelson, Sid Moore, Dr. Hutcheson, ?, Dr. Hall, A.R. Babington, Bert Cotter, Harry McKay, ?, Ernie Arnett ?, ?, ?, Shorty Fletcher ?, ?, ?, ?, ?, Fred Jameson, ?, William Wood (father in-law to Chat Clark), J.N. Gale ?

Fait partie de City of Melfort collection
Melfort's first Council 1907: Back Row L-R: D. Nesbit, J. Carney, J. H. Hatton, Front Row L- R: G. B. Jameson, G. B. Johnston (Mayor), L. J. Greenwood, Wm. Armstrong. The wood frame is gilded in a hold colour and has A decorative moulded edge, the matte is green in colour.
